Riding the Wave of Transformation: Functional Architecture for Agile Development Success
In the dynamic landscape of software development, embracing transformation is paramount. Agile methodologies thrive on iterative cycles and rapid adjustments, demanding a flexible architectural foundation. A well-defined functional architecture serves as the bedrock, enabling seamless integration, scalability, and robustness essential for Agile achievement.
By adhering to a modular design pattern, teams can break down complex applications into manageable components. This granularity allows for independent development, testing, and deployment, fostering coordination among team members and accelerating the development stream.
Moreover, a functional architecture promotes loose coupling between modules, minimizing dependencies and reducing the impact of changes in one area on others. This essential characteristic ensures that Agile teams can quickly iterate and adapt to evolving requirements without disrupting the entire system.

Delivering Value Iteratively: Functional Agile Architecture in Action
Functional agile architecture empowers teams to effectively produce value iteratively. This approach focuses on building reusable components that can evolve over time, allowing for continuous improvement and adaptability in the face of fluctuating requirements. By adopting a functional design philosophy, organizations can maximize their ability to adjust to market dynamics and provide solutions that genuinely address customer needs.
- For example: A software development team using functional agile architecture might initiate by building a core set of extensible components that form the foundation of their application.
- Following this, they can iterate and build upon these structures by adding new features and functionalities in small, defined increments.
- Such approach allows the team to perpetually gather feedback from users and stakeholders, guiding the course of development and ensuring that the final product fulfills their evolving needs.
